Analysis

Switzerland recorded 1,653 Tonnes live weight for catches - inland waters in 2010.

That represents a change of down 2.0% on the previous year and down 0.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, catches - inland waters in Switzerland peaked at 4,386 Tonnes live weight in 1986 and was at its lowest, 1,377 Tonnes live weight, in 2007.

That places Switzerland 17th out of 42 countries with data for 2010,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 61 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1950s 2,050 Tonnes live weight 2,000 Tonnes live weight 2,500 Tonnes live weight 10
1960s 2,990 Tonnes live weight 2,500 Tonnes live weight 3,500 Tonnes live weight 10
1970s 3,533 Tonnes live weight 2,400 Tonnes live weight 3,922 Tonnes live weight 10
1980s 3,731 Tonnes live weight 3,149 Tonnes live weight 4,386 Tonnes live weight 10
1990s 2,171 Tonnes live weight 1,481 Tonnes live weight 3,599 Tonnes live weight 10
2000s 1,588 Tonnes live weight 1,377 Tonnes live weight 1,815 Tonnes live weight 10
2010s 1,653 Tonnes live weight 1,653 Tonnes live weight 1,653 Tonnes live weight 1
